How To MEASURE Your Wrist (for a watch)

You have to know how to measure your wrist for a watch. But are you doing it the right way? There are 2 things you have to take into consideration when measuring your wrist size: how to properly do it and how it actually translates to a metal bracelet, leather band or nato strap size.
